Viral UK Baker Brings Macro-Counted Protein Bakes & Treats to Oswestry Indoor Market
From Lockdown Passion Project to Market Anchor: Bake Baby & Buff Bowls Opens at Oswestry Indoor Market
When local mother-of-two Abi first picked up her baking tins six years ago to beat lockdown boredom, she never imagined it would mark the start of one of the town’s most dynamic culinary journeys. Now, after years of building a dedicated following, she is taking a major step forward by opening her first permanent unit at the Oswestry Indoor Market on Saturday, 15th August at 9:00am.
The launch of Bake Baby & Buff Bowls represents more than just a personal milestone; it highlights the strength and ambition within the local enterprise community. What started as casual Facebook posts of home-baked treats quickly turned into an eager customer base demanding more. However, scaling a solo venture alongside parenting brought real challenges.
For years, Abi balanced late-night baking sessions with an exhausting travel schedule, taking her outdoor stall across Wales, London, and beyond. While successful, the constant road travel took its toll. Earlier this year, seeking a better balance for her family, Abi began looking at traditional employment options, until a rare opportunity appeared online.
A unit had opened up inside the Oswestry Indoor Market. Permanent spots in the market are highly sought after, offering a stable foothold for growing businesses. Securing the space allowed Abi to trade grueling travel for a permanent, central location right where her journey began.
Innovation Meets Health on the High Street
Alongside her signature celebration cakes, Abi is introducing a fresh concept to the local food scene: macro-counted, high-protein, and low-fat meals designed for health-conscious consumers and gym-goers.
Recognising a gap in the market for quick, nutritious food, she launched her “Buff Bakes” line in January. Crafting macro-balanced protein treats is notoriously difficult due to the complex food science involved, making Abi one of only a small handful of bakers in the UK producing them.
Visitors to the new stall can look forward to town-first offerings, including custom macro-balanced meal bowls, sweet potato jackets, viral high-protein cookies, and cake slices, alongside traditional treats and hot and cold beverages.
A Welcome Addition to the Local Economy
Abi’s decision to anchor her business indoors reflects a growing confidence in local trading hubs. Rather than viewing neighboring vendors as competition, she plans to actively collaborate with stallholders offering complementary products and event supplies, creating a stronger overall destination for shoppers.
For Oswestry, the addition of a unique, forward-thinking food concept adds extra vibrancy to the indoor market, encouraging footfall and demonstrating how micro-businesses can successfully transition into established high-street traders.
